I recommend you to write separate check.
I don't think sending only those documents would be good enough. You will also need to provide an evidence of continuous residence since june 24.
As you are in f1-status, following documents can be used to establish continuous residence.
1) School records
2) Employment records - if you are working in school, then send your pay stub, if you are working using CPT , then send pay stub.
3) Medical records
4) insurance, car registration
5) utility bils, rental agreement, phone bill
6) bank documents.
there are many more. let us know what documents you can provide
Sending your application with documents you mentioned is not good enough. let us know if you need any info.
